Frequently Asked Questions

Are there any local travel agents physically located in Jarbidge, Nevada?

Given Jarbidge's extremely remote location and tiny population (under 50 residents), there are no traditional brick-and-mortar travel agencies in the town itself. For local expertise, you would need to look for agents based in larger regional hubs like Elko, NV, or Twin Falls, ID, who specialize in rural and adventure travel to Northeastern Nevada.

What type of travel services are most important for a trip to Jarbidge, NV?

A knowledgeable agent for Jarbidge should specialize in rugged, off-grid travel logistics. Key services include arranging high-clearance or 4x4 vehicle rentals for the remote mountain roads, booking rustic cabin or campground stays (like the Jarbidge Inn), and providing detailed information on seasonal access, as many roads are impassable in winter.

How can I find a travel agent familiar with Jarbidge's unique attractions and history?

Search for agents affiliated with consortia like Virtuoso or Travel Leaders who list 'Adventure Travel' or 'American West' as specialties, and inquire directly about their experience with Nevada's Ruby Mountains and Jarbidge's ghost town history. Alternatively, contact the Elko Convention & Visitors Authority for referrals to regional specialists.

What should I expect to pay for using a travel agent to plan a trip to Jarbidge?

Fees vary, but given the highly customized planning required for this destination, many agents charge a professional planning fee (typically $100-$300) to coordinate logistics like remote accommodations and complex transportation. This fee is often separate from the cost of your booked travel and may be waived if your total booking reaches a certain threshold.

Why would I use a travel agent instead of booking a trip to Jarbidge myself online?

A specialist agent provides critical local knowledge you can't find online, such as real-time road conditions for NV-226, the best times to visit for wildflowers or fall colors, and connections to local guides for hiking, fishing, or exploring the Jarbidge Wilderness. They handle complex logistics, saving you significant research time and preventing costly errors in this isolated area.
